This track by the Misfits serves as a potent example of the band's signature blend of punk energy and gothic horror aesthetics. Released alongside other notable works like 'Hate The Living, Love The Dead' and 'Dig Up Her Bones', the song exemplifies the band's ability to craft dramatic, theatrical narratives through their music. The recording captures the raw intensity characteristic of the genre, featuring the band's iconic vocal style and driving rhythms that have become synonymous with their legacy. It stands as a definitive piece in their discography, reflecting the enduring appeal of their unique fusion of rock and the macabre themes that inspired their early success.
